Madasom (23), a ‘late-starter’, is aiming for his first tour victory in the last tournament of the year.
On the 16th, on the first day of the PLK Pacific Rings Korea Championship, the second tournament of the Korean Women’s Professional Golf (KLPGA) Tour held at the Twin Doves Golf Club (par 72) near Ho Chi Minh City, Vietnam, Madasom hit 6 birdies without bogey and scored 6 under par. wrote it down It is tied for the lead with Ko Ji-woo (20), who reduced 6 strokes with 7 birdies and 1 bogey.
Madasom, born in 1999, turned professional in 2020 and is a late-born rookie who debuted on her regular tour this year. She has Choi Hye-jin and Lee So-mi as classmates.
